>> I inherited a set of OpenVAS installations and am in the process of
>> setting up a process to install and maintain OpenVAS on new systems.
>> I am currently testing the concept on virtual machines, but will be
>> performing the final roll-out on some much beefier physical boxes.
>>
>> I have tried following the instructions on the OpenVAS web site using
>> CentOS 6 and 7. I have tried skipping the initial update. So fat, all
>> variations have failed.
>>
>> Here is the summary of what I've done (verbose log attached.)
>> Install CentOS6, minimal from ISO, all defaults.
>> Enable eth0.
>> ssh to the VM. (Verbose log attached begins here.)
>> Install wget.
>>
>> Follow instructions at: http://www.openvas.org/install-packages-v7.html
>>
>> # wget -q -O - http://www.atomicorp.com/installers/atomic |sh
>> (no problem)
>> # yum upgrade
>> (no problem)
>> # yum install openvas
>> (many dependency errors ending with:)
